CTW Cayman operates the web-based HTML5 gaming platform G123.jp, offering free-to-play games based on Japanese animations, including Queen's Blade, So I'm a Spider, So What?, and Goblin Slayer. The platform features 29 games, with 11 in pre-registration. The Group provides a platform for game developers to generate revenue and reach an international audience through shared revenue from players' in-game purchases. It operates in Japan, Singapore, Taiwan, and China, excluding Taiwan, with the majority of revenue derived from Japan, and has one reporting segment focused on game distribution and related services.
LENSAR Inc is a commercial-stage medical device company focused on designing, developing, and marketing a femtosecond laser system for the treatment of cataracts. The company Laser System incorporates a range of proprietary technologies designed to assist the surgeon in obtaining visual outcomes, efficiency, and reproducibility by providing imaging, simplified procedure planning, efficient design, and precision. Its product portfolio consists of the LENSAR Laser System with Streamline IV and IntelliAxis and its associated consumable components. Geographically, the company generates the majority of its revenue from the United States, followed by Europe and Asia.
